Farjoun E. D., Ivanov S. O., Krasilnikov A. et al., Journal of Algebra 2025 Vol. 675 P. 273–288
We consider several types of non-existence theorems for functors. For example, there are no nontrivial functors from the category of groups (or the category of pointed sets, or vector spaces) to any small category. Dmitri Panchenko, Hyperboreus 2017 Vol. 23 No. 2 P. 208–223
The way of argumentation employed by the Eleatic philosophers was repeatedly compared with methods of demonstration characteristic for Greek mathematics. The paper addresses a particular type of argument, argumentum ad impossibile, found in both Zeno’s antinomies and an ancient demonstration of the incommensurability of the side and diagonal of a square. Lečić N. D., В кн.: Аристотелевское наследие как конституирующий элемент европейской рациональности.: М.: Аквилон, 2017. С. 31–42.
In his reasoning concerning the relationship between surface or visible superficies (understood as the boundary or the limit of a body) and color (De sensu 439a19–b17), Aristotle asserts that the Pythagoreans called the surface (ἐπιφάνεια) color (χροιά), i.e. that they made no terminological difference between the former and the latter. Lečić N. D., Платоновские исследования 2016 № 2 С. 258–278
In Theaetetus (145a–148a), Plato brings up Theaetetus’ retelling of a lesson by Theodorus of Cyrene, in which the latter demonstrated the incommensurability of the sides of squares containing three, five, and up to seventeen square feet with the side of one square foot. Gavrilovich M., The De Morgan Gazette 2014 Vol. 5 No. 4 P. 23–32
We observe that some natural mathematical definitions are lifting properties relative to simplest counterexamples, namely the definitions of surjectivity and injectivity of maps, as well as of being connected, separation axioms T0 and T1 in topology, having dense image, induced (pullback) topology, and every real-valued function being bounded (on a connected domain).
